How Does A Mortgage Broker Get Paid? – Tridac Mortgage – Generally speaking I get compensated 0.80% of your mortgage amount for a fixed 5 year mortgage. If the term is less, then I earn less finders fees closer to 0.65%. If the term is more than 5 years, like a 10 year term mortgage then the compensation is closer to 1.25% of the mortgage amount.

Do I need to pay mortgage broker fees? – Some mortgage brokers will also charge clients a cancellation fee-an additional cost from $300 to 1% of the mortgage amount-should you cancel your mortgage before you close the deal. (This can happen when you’re working with more than one broker and opt for a mortgage with a better rate.
Mortgage Brokers | R3 Mortgages | London – We normally charge a fee of 499 for arranging a residential / buy to let mortgage. Complex cases (e.g. adverse credit history, Limited company buy to lets & multiple applicants) may have a higher fee. For offshore & expat mortgages a typical fee of 1% of the mortgage loan size applies.
